Marcus M. Haskell

Born in Chelsea, MA, on February 12, 1843, Haskell joined the Army in August 1862. He was wounded at least six different times before finally leaving the Army in June 1865.

Citation: Although wounded and exposed to a heavy fire from the enemy, at the risk of his own life he rescued a badly wounded comrade and succeeded in conveying him to a place of safety.
